    err yup TKO600. I run the .82 overdrive with a TRD 2.92:1 final drive and tick over at a wonderfully lazy 1800rpm at 100kph.

    Also does 0-100 in sub 4 sec so any clown that tells you that ratio is too tall is talking out their arse and has no idea what torque means

    Cross the line in 3rd gear around 6500rpm Those numbers are on my Nankang street tyres so yes there is some wheelspin. Best 60ft time was 1.8secs so with Street ETs i should knock a coupla 10ths off that easy.

    i think an r154 will handle up to 600hp if you replace the 1st gear thrust washer (which is the only known weak point of the box) and dont drive like a wanker. As mentioned tho mate, if you are realistic and want times - an auto is the only way to go. I'm changing my ma61 back to auto when i one day get the time and money for my project...
